The critically-acclaimed Siouxsie and the Banshees remasters series continues with extended versions of the classic albums A Kiss In The Dreamhouse, Hyaena, Nocturne and Tinderbox.
All remasters overseen by Steven Severin, with extensive sleevenote essays by Paul Morley. Siouxsie And The Banshees – A Kiss In The Dreamhouse
“Fraught blasphemous tales of violence, loss, sex, claustrophobia, [and] their obsession with sin and self.” – Paul Morley (sleevenotes) “A feat of imagination scarcely ever recorded. It’s breathtaking. This music will take your breath away." (NME review, 1982) 1982’s ‘A Kiss In The Dreamhouse’ was the Banshees fifth studio album. A critical success, hailed by many as their most accomplished experimental album, it was also a commercial hit, peaking at Number 11 in the UK charts.
‘A Kiss In The Dreamhouse’ is now digitally remastered with four bonus tracks including the epic 12” versions of Fireworks (Number 22 in the UK Charts, May 1982), Slowdive (Number 41 in October 1982) and the previously unreleased demo versions of Painted Bird and Cascade. Tracklisting: 01: Cascade

16: Voodoo Dolly Siouxsie and The Banshees – Hyaena “Radiating unholy light, outwardly calm but containing a storm of passion” – Paul Morley (sleevenotes) The sixth studio album by Siouxsie and The Banshees from 1984, and the only to feature Robert Smith on guitar. This classic album has been digitally remastered and now boasts four bonus tracks including Dear Prudence, a cover that became the band's biggest hit in the UK (reaching number 3 in the charts) but was released at the time as a stand-alone single. . The song was intended to be a stand-alone single in the UK. Also included are the Glamour Mix of Dazzle and the Previously Unreleased songs Baby Piano - Part One and Baby Piano - Part Two, both featuring Robert Smith. Tracklisting: 01: Dazzle (Single version)
